相关DQL语句
一、变量的定义与使用
1.方法一
#定义变量
set @userName='Season';
#读取变量
select @userName as '结果名称_1';
运行效果如下
2.方法二
#读取时包含赋值操作
select @userName:='Autumn' as '结果名称_2';
运行效果如下
二、有关运算
1.四则运算
set @x=5,@y=7;
select @x+@y as '加法运算',@x-@y as '减法运算',
@x*@y as '乘法运算',@x/@y as '除法运算',@x % @y as '取模(余)运算';
运行结果如下
2.关系运算
#关系运算
select @x > @y;
select @x <= @y;
运行结果如下
tip:0代表true,1代表false
3.逻辑运算
select true or false;
#[&(and),|(or)]仍然适用
运行结果如下
tip同上
4.关于浮点数计算
set @dx=0.11,@dy=55.5;
select @dx + @dy; #计算结果有很多0
如下图
#可用以下方式清0
set @result=@dx + @dy;
select @result;
运行结果如下